Commit Graph

  • 9404f52d33 Replace caps.Type struct with an interface Zygmunt Krynicki 2016-01-13 19:25:56 +01:00
  • 3397cb3d07 Merge remote-tracking branch 'upstream/master' into refactor/bootloader-cleanup Michael Vogt 2016-01-13 17:41:27 +01:00
  • 15c5e64e53 Merge pull request #313 from mvo5/bugfix/no-more-clickdeb Michael Vogt 2016-01-13 17:40:57 +01:00
  • a5b216390e use simpler names for bootmode Michael Vogt 2016-01-13 17:34:11 +01:00
  • fdfe7bf3c0 Merge pull request #311 from mvo5/bugfix/no-more-ab-partition Michael Vogt 2016-01-13 17:30:48 +01:00
  • dc7971631b Add missing grub SetBootVer test, simplify utils Michael Vogt 2016-01-13 17:27:10 +01:00
  • faab897eb3 Move dir/file handling into grub/uboot types Michael Vogt 2016-01-13 17:12:51 +01:00
  • 1fbc695bb1 Use shorter filenames Michael Vogt 2016-01-13 17:00:36 +01:00
  • 92484c987e Simplify further, shorter names, less cruft Michael Vogt 2016-01-13 16:59:20 +01:00
  • 8ed45a2903 remove unused bootloaderNameGrub and bootloader.Name() Michael Vogt 2016-01-13 16:44:54 +01:00
  • 8cf308f945 simplify tests Michael Vogt 2016-01-13 16:38:07 +01:00
  • 0267ca7328 remove bootLoader.BootDir() Michael Vogt 2016-01-13 16:36:33 +01:00
  • 6c46fda083 remove dirs.go cruft Michael Vogt 2016-01-13 16:27:35 +01:00
  • a8b09164f7 partition/bootloader.go: clarify FIXME Michael Vogt 2016-01-13 15:56:43 +01:00
  • 8301062d0c Remove obsolete docs/hashes.md Michael Vogt 2016-01-13 15:54:21 +01:00
  • 21e45f914e Merge remote-tracking branch 'upstream/master' into bugfix/no-more-clickdeb Michael Vogt 2016-01-13 15:53:52 +01:00
  • cb1739c402 Merge remote-tracking branch 'upstream/master' into bugfix/no-more-ab-partition Michael Vogt 2016-01-13 15:41:50 +01:00
  • 1e6db0e43a Adress review comments (thanks Gustavo) Michael Vogt 2016-01-13 15:41:09 +01:00
  • fab648b2a1 Merge remote-tracking branch 'upstream/master' into bugfix/no-more-ab-partition Michael Vogt 2016-01-13 15:40:24 +01:00
  • 7be6bafa50 Merge pull request #309 from mvo5/bugfix/no-more-si Michael Vogt 2016-01-13 15:39:39 +01:00
  • a2cb82f74e Merge remote-tracking branch 'upstream/master' into bugfix/no-more-si Michael Vogt 2016-01-13 15:32:06 +01:00
  • b5c4c0216b add FIXME: for store-url assertion Michael Vogt 2016-01-13 15:27:17 +01:00
  • d7ee9fd6f3 Merge pull request #272 from mvo5/refactor/snap-file Michael Vogt 2016-01-13 15:26:10 +01:00
  • 2ee6893622 drop useless comment from snap.File.Install() Michael Vogt 2016-01-13 14:58:27 +01:00
  • 999263ef80 Merge remote-tracking branch 'upstream/master' Samuele Pedroni 2016-01-13 14:56:11 +01:00
  • 8cc2f65b67 Merge remote-tracking branch 'upstream/master' into bugfix/no-more-clickdeb Michael Vogt 2016-01-13 14:53:06 +01:00
  • ea42fd4633 the store revision is an integer! Michael Vogt 2016-01-13 12:55:34 +01:00
  • b985d87405 Merge pull request #314 from emgee/asserts-toolbelt-more-keyid Samuele Pedroni 2016-01-13 12:43:31 +01:00
  • d97833d2d5 Merge branch 'master' into asserts-toolbelt-more-keyid Matt Goodall 2016-01-13 11:17:56 +00:00
  • a3adae1bef Merge pull request #318 from stevenwilkin/return-by-reference-not-value Samuele Pedroni 2016-01-13 12:03:09 +01:00
  • a29c94c805 Merge pull request #307 from pedronis/asserts-exported-n-explicit-backstores Samuele Pedroni 2016-01-13 11:53:07 +01:00
  • c42367744f releasing package ubuntu-snappy version 1.7.2+20160113-0ubuntu1 1.7.2+20160113ubuntu1 Michael Vogt 2016-01-13 11:26:01 +01:00
  • f19025c5c4 Fix return. Matt Goodall 2016-01-13 10:02:51 +00:00
  • 796d60f1f4 Merge remote-tracking branch 'upstream/master' Samuele Pedroni 2016-01-13 10:08:08 +01:00
  • b627ac7ba5 Merge pull request #315 from mvo5/feature/provisioning Michael Vogt 2016-01-13 09:46:51 +01:00
  • 64f9a1b19c Improve pub key spec parsing error message. Matt Goodall 2016-01-12 22:30:40 +00:00
  • 0630877dff tweak doc comment Samuele Pedroni 2016-01-12 23:16:49 +01:00
  • 17cb8cce98 Merge remote-tracking branch 'upstream/master' into asserts-exported-n-explicit-backstores Samuele Pedroni 2016-01-12 23:14:26 +01:00
  • fbaddb455e Merge pull request #304 from pedronis/asserts-backstore-interface-take2 Samuele Pedroni 2016-01-12 23:13:52 +01:00
  • e8c4ea2d63 make nullBackstore an internal fallback detail, adjust errors Samuele Pedroni 2016-01-12 23:13:14 +01:00
  • 97bcb01898 Revert "Keep writing a DEBIAN/manifest or the store won't accept uploads" Michael Vogt 2016-01-12 21:13:22 +01:00
  • 4391943fdb fix these Samuele Pedroni 2016-01-12 19:16:19 +01:00
  • 6d8094c29b introduce NullBackstore, useful for signing-only database uses and for tests, make both backstores mandatory and panic otherwise Samuele Pedroni 2016-01-12 19:14:53 +01:00
  • 07cf4933d1 s/Filesytem/FS/ Samuele Pedroni 2016-01-12 18:26:32 +01:00
  • d21dba3931 introduce and use helper to get the primary key of an assertion type Samuele Pedroni 2016-01-12 18:10:12 +01:00
  • 610eb1abcd Merge remote-tracking branch 'upstream/master' into refactor/snap-file Michael Vogt 2016-01-12 17:41:12 +01:00
  • 1ef69db798 Merge pull request #278 from stevenwilkin/get-package-from-snapd-api Gustavo Niemeyer 2016-01-12 14:27:37 -02:00
  • 306e0c5c0d Merge pull request #317 from mvo5/bugfix/no-more-clickdeb-minimal Michael Vogt 2016-01-12 17:07:02 +01:00
  • a744abc5be Return by reference rather than by value Steven Wilkin 2016-01-12 16:05:04 +00:00
  • dc7056e97d Retrieve package details from snapd API Steven Wilkin 2016-01-04 15:16:23 +07:00
  • 219a8bf9cf remove user-visible support for installing clickdebs or building clickdebs Michael Vogt 2016-01-11 14:52:21 +01:00
  • 64d00b5bc4 Merge remote-tracking branch 'upstream/master' into bugfix/no-more-clickdeb Michael Vogt 2016-01-12 15:44:42 +01:00
  • b973734e34 Keep writing a DEBIAN/manifest or the store won't accept uploads Michael Vogt 2016-01-12 15:09:46 +01:00
  • 74edb9e610 remove commented out import Samuele Pedroni 2016-01-12 15:04:38 +01:00
  • e2bae2d94c Merge branch 'asserts-backstore-interface-take2' into asserts-exported-n-explicit-backstores Samuele Pedroni 2016-01-12 15:04:12 +01:00
  • 2eda6a55f1 Merge pull request #296 from mvo5/feature/short-envs Michael Vogt 2016-01-12 14:55:20 +01:00
  • f1f0c12974 store the Revision we get from the server in the locally store manifest Michael Vogt 2016-01-12 14:52:15 +01:00
  • 42a30068cc declunkify doc comments a little bit Samuele Pedroni 2016-01-12 14:47:33 +01:00
  • bc9dde4d32 kill really old SNAPP_ vars Michael Vogt 2016-01-12 13:06:46 +01:00
  • 248d550dad Merge remote-tracking branch 'upstream/master' into feature/short-envs Michael Vogt 2016-01-12 13:00:18 +01:00
  • 55065e51fc docs/security.md: fix SNAP_APP_ARCH -> SNAP_ARCH Michael Vogt 2016-01-12 12:33:15 +01:00
  • 10ec7349d7 add OS/Kernel to install.yaml Michael Vogt 2016-01-12 12:27:04 +01:00
  • 2e10ec5ba8 Remove debugging panic. Matt Goodall 2016-01-12 11:08:08 +00:00
  • de835b4758 Merge pull request #288 from mvo5/bugfix/snappy-post-update-list-output-all-snaps John Lenton 2016-01-12 10:56:55 +00:00
  • 5a6504f633 Fixup toolbelt to use exposed key ID. Matt Goodall 2016-01-12 10:34:36 +00:00
  • 0487a31bb2 Merge pull request #308 from mvo5/refactor/snaps-no-apps Michael Vogt 2016-01-12 08:46:36 +01:00
  • 0d68e315a2 integration-tests/tests/build_test.go: its ok if basic is in the first line :) Michael Vogt 2016-01-12 08:35:48 +01:00
  • eea8474a40 Merge pull request #4 from elopio/refactor/all-snaps-integration-tests Michael Vogt 2016-01-12 08:26:22 +01:00
  • 9a22e2d74e remove more click specific bits&pieces Michael Vogt 2016-01-12 08:01:04 +01:00
  • 60c7891987 Fmt. Leo Arias 2016-01-12 00:59:28 -06:00
  • be22888d67 Removed the unused parts of the old failover. Leo Arias 2016-01-12 00:58:43 -06:00
  • f571624f76 Updated the rest of the failover tests. Leo Arias 2016-01-12 00:51:24 -06:00
  • 65fa7275b8 Updated the rest of the zero size failover tests. Leo Arias 2016-01-12 00:22:28 -06:00
  • 14ca1ee8c3 Updated the first failover test. Leo Arias 2016-01-12 00:03:45 -06:00
  • 110eef2de8 Added a change snap callback and moved the update helpers out of common. Leo Arias 2016-01-11 23:19:09 -06:00
  • 07e60f354f Removed unused switchChannelVersionWithBackup. Leo Arias 2016-01-11 19:12:03 -06:00
  • 27247b25b6 Use only long option names in snap add-cap Zygmunt Krynicki 2016-01-11 17:39:11 +01:00
  • bb76b0b329 Revert "Use named arguments for "snap add-cap"" Zygmunt Krynicki 2016-01-11 17:35:30 +01:00
  • 5ac60ff5fa Simplify the snap.File interface now that clickdeb is gone Michael Vogt 2016-01-11 17:33:53 +01:00
  • b8d9eda257 Remove snap/clickdeb Michael Vogt 2016-01-11 17:27:13 +01:00
  • 7f96bf08ea Kill Legacy build Michael Vogt 2016-01-11 17:25:02 +01:00
  • 83d5be05f6 Use only squashfs based test snaps Michael Vogt 2016-01-11 17:21:38 +01:00
  • d86b03aa1b Prepare to stop using BuildLegacySnap in the tests Michael Vogt 2016-01-11 16:33:52 +01:00
  • 4b0d3fc3d9 Remove more clickdeb Michael Vogt 2016-01-11 15:53:02 +01:00
  • 5ea4bfeb55 refactor the build_test.go in preparation for the clickdeb remoal Michael Vogt 2016-01-11 15:47:44 +01:00
  • b1157c0491 remove user-visible support for installing clickdebs or building clickdebs Michael Vogt 2016-01-11 14:52:21 +01:00
  • 0fc594ab6a Merge branch 'bugfix/no-more-si' into bugfix/no-more-ab-partition Michael Vogt 2016-01-11 12:21:57 +01:00
  • ccdb70b5b8 Remove unused code Michael Vogt 2016-01-11 12:18:58 +01:00
  • 83e34cd536 Refactor partition/ package and remove Partition type Michael Vogt 2016-01-11 12:15:27 +01:00
  • 166cdcbaa2 re-enable testing in snappy Michael Vogt 2016-01-11 12:01:09 +01:00
  • 28e4ac8e90 remove mounts.go Michael Vogt 2016-01-11 11:47:12 +01:00
  • d75a01154f remove all the a/b partition support Michael Vogt 2016-01-11 11:44:04 +01:00
  • 31933d383c remove etc/grub.d/09_snappy: no longer needed Michael Vogt 2016-01-11 11:07:37 +01:00
  • 4eaeb7e045 Merge branch 'asserts-backstore-interface-take2' into asserts-exported-n-explicit-backstores Samuele Pedroni 2016-01-11 11:05:55 +01:00
  • da54a68126 debian/control: remove system-image-cli and ubuntu-core-upgrader dependencies Michael Vogt 2016-01-11 11:05:42 +01:00
  • c3297ead44 Merge remote-tracking branch 'upstream/master' into asserts-backstore-interface-take2 Samuele Pedroni 2016-01-11 11:04:00 +01:00
  • d9cfba7d53 Delete the code that deals with the SystemImage server Michael Vogt 2016-01-11 10:59:26 +01:00
  • 918f7499c8 Remove usage of the SystemImage repository Michael Vogt 2016-01-11 10:51:53 +01:00
  • ca1426fcbd Merge pull request #302 from pedronis/asserts-export-assemble Samuele Pedroni 2016-01-11 10:48:58 +01:00
  • 9514c5792c rename SNAP_DIR to SNAP (as discussed on irc) Michael Vogt 2016-01-11 08:10:25 +01:00